Apoligies for the world's cr@piest photo, but these are mini hubcaps (I think), I welded a strip across the centre of the wheel with a speed nut in the middle and drilled the centre of the hubcap and secured it with a cap head bolt. A neater way would be three small tabs welded to the wheel and small self tappers around the edge of the hubcap.

Well these are Minor Commercial caps that my car was wearing for a while. Same as the normal ones but without the "M" in the middle. Austins had a smoother edge design with an A in the centre and again there were commercial ones without, like the Sun-tor's. Hope that's of some help!
